हेक्साडेसिमल प्रणाली संख्याओं को दर्शाने के लिए कंप्यूटिंग में सबसे अधिक उपयोग किए जाने वाले नोटेशन में से एक है, खासकर जब मेमोरी एड्रेस और अन्य क्षेत्रों के साथ काम करते समय जहां लंबी संख्याओं के कॉम्पैक्ट प्रतिनिधित्व की आवश्यकता होती है। पहली नज़र में, यदि आपने कभी इसका उपयोग नहीं किया है तो यह जटिल लग सकता है, लेकिन एक बार जब आप मूल बातें समझ लेंगे, तो दशमलव को हेक्साडेसिमल में परिवर्तित करना बहुत आसान हो जाएगा।
इस रूपांतरण को समझने के लिए, यह ध्यान में रखना आवश्यक है कि दशमलव प्रणाली, जिसे हम सबसे अधिक दैनिक उपयोग करते हैं, और हेक्साडेसिमल प्रणाली, जिसमें अतिरिक्त प्रतीकों का एक सेट होता है, दोनों कैसे काम करती हैं। इस लेख में, हम आपको यह समझने के लिए आवश्यक चरण और विवरण प्रदान करेंगे कि विशेष रूप से स्वचालित टूल पर निर्भर हुए बिना इन रूपांतरणों को कैसे किया जाए।
दशमलव प्रणाली क्या है?
दशमलव प्रणाली, या आधार 10, मनुष्य द्वारा अपने दैनिक जीवन में सबसे अधिक उपयोग किया जाता है क्योंकि हमारे पास दस अंक हैं: 0, 1, 2, 3, 4, 5, 6, 7, 8 और 9। दशमलव में प्रत्येक स्थिति संख्या अपने स्थान के आधार पर 10 की शक्ति का प्रतिनिधित्व करती है, अर्थात, संख्या 235 को दो सौ पैंतीस के रूप में पढ़ा जाता है क्योंकि यह 2*10^2 + 3*10^1 + 5*10^0 का योग है। यह प्रणाली लोगों के लिए सहज और उपयोग में आसान है।
हेक्साडेसिमल प्रणाली क्या है?
हेक्साडेसिमल, या आधार 16, प्रणाली एक कॉम्पैक्ट नोटेशन है जो संख्याओं को दर्शाने के लिए अंक और अक्षर दोनों का उपयोग करती है। पहले दस मान (0 से 9 तक) दशमलव प्रणाली के बराबर हैं, लेकिन फिर अक्षर आते हैं: ए, बी, सी, डी, ई और एफ, जो मान 10, 11, 12 के बराबर हैं , 13, 14 और 15 क्रमशः। अक्षरों का उपयोग दशमलव प्रणाली की तुलना में बड़ी संख्याओं को कम अंकों के साथ प्रदर्शित करने की अनुमति देता है।
उदाहरण के लिए, दशमलव प्रणाली में संख्या 255 का प्रतिनिधित्व करने के लिए हमें हेक्साडेसिमल में केवल दो अंकों की आवश्यकता है: एफएफ। वास्तव में, इस सघनता के कारण, हेक्साडेसिमल प्रणाली का व्यापक रूप से कंप्यूटिंग संदर्भों में उपयोग किया जाता है जहां बाइनरी संख्याओं को संभाला जाता है, क्योंकि मनुष्यों के लिए 1 और 0 की लंबी स्ट्रिंग को पढ़ने की तुलना में इसकी व्याख्या करना आसान है।
दशमलव से हेक्साडेसिमल में बदलने के चरण
अब जब हम दोनों प्रणालियों को समझ गए हैं, तो हम सीख सकते हैं कि उनके बीच किसी संख्या को कैसे परिवर्तित किया जाए। दशमलव से हेक्साडेसिमल में जाने की प्रक्रिया में दशमलव संख्या जिसे हम परिवर्तित करना चाहते हैं और 16 के बीच क्रमिक विभाजनों की एक श्रृंखला शामिल होती है, जब तक कि भागफल शून्य न हो जाए। विभाजन का प्रत्येक शेष हेक्साडेसिमल समतुल्य बन जाता है।
रूपांतरण उदाहरण: कल्पना कीजिए कि हम दशमलव संख्या 196 को हेक्साडेसिमल में बदलना चाहते हैं। सबसे पहले, हम 196 को 16 से विभाजित करते हैं:
196 X 16 = 12 4 के शेषफल के साथ 12 को अक्षर द्वारा दर्शाया जाता है C हेक्साडेसिमल में, और 4 वैसा ही रहता है, इसलिए परिणाम C4 है।
इसी प्रक्रिया को किसी भी बड़ी संख्या के लिए दोहराया जा सकता है, और महत्वपूर्ण बात यह याद रखना है कि 9 से अधिक होने पर शेषफल को संबंधित अक्षरों से बदल दें।
रूपांतरण के लिए प्रत्यक्ष एल्गोरिदम
दशमलव से हेक्साडेसिमल में बदलने का दूसरा तरीका अधिक प्रत्यक्ष प्रक्रिया का उपयोग करना है, जिसे कंप्यूटिंग में एल्गोरिदम के रूप में जाना जाता है। यह प्रक्रिया बिना यह प्रयोग किए क्रमिक विभाजनों के विचार को स्वचालित कर देती है कि 16 की कौन सी शक्ति दशमलव संख्या के लिए सबसे उपयुक्त है।
उदाहरण के लिए, यदि हम संख्या 213 को दशमलव में बदलना चाहते हैं, तो हम गणना करते हैं: 213 X 16 = 13, 5 के शेषफल के साथ हेक्साडेसिमल में 13 अक्षर द्वारा दर्शाया जाता है D, इसलिए, दशमलव में संख्या 213 का अनुवाद होता है D5 हेक्साडेसिमल में. जैसा कि आप देख सकते हैं, यह विधि हमें जल्दी और कुशलता से रूपांतरण करने की अनुमति देती है।
दशमलव से हेक्साडेसिमल रूपांतरण तालिका
नीचे, हम आपके लिए एक तालिका छोड़ते हैं जो छोटी संख्याओं को दशमलव से हेक्साडेसिमल में बदलने के लिए त्वरित संदर्भ के रूप में कार्य करती है:
दशमलव (आधार 10) | हेक्साडेसिमल (बेस 16) |
---|---|
0 | 0 |
1 | 1 |
2 | 2 |
3 | 3 |
4 | 4 |
5 | 5 |
6 | 6 |
7 | 7 |
8 | 8 |
9 | 9 |
10 | A |
11 | B |
12 | C |
13 | D |
14 | E |
15 | F |
इस तालिका को याद रखने से आपको त्वरित रूपांतरण करने में मदद मिलेगी, खासकर छोटी संख्याओं के लिए। इसके अतिरिक्त, आधारों के बीच वृद्धि पैटर्न को देखते समय, आप देखेंगे कि हर बार जब आप हेक्साडेसिमल में स्थिति बढ़ाते हैं, तो यह 16 की अधिक शक्ति जोड़ने जैसा होता है, जिससे संख्या दशमलव की तुलना में तेजी से बढ़ती है।
स्रोत: LasMatesFaciles.com
दशमलव से हेक्साडेसिमल में बदलने के लिए स्वचालित उपकरण
अंत में, जबकि मैन्युअल रूप से रूपांतरण करना दोनों आधारों को समझने का एक अच्छा अभ्यास है, ऐसे ऑनलाइन उपकरण भी हैं जो आपके लिए स्वचालित रूप से काम कर सकते हैं। ये उपकरण आपको एक दशमलव संख्या दर्ज करने और एक क्लिक से उसके हेक्साडेसिमल समकक्ष प्राप्त करने की अनुमति देते हैं।
यदि आपको प्रक्रिया को तेज़ करने की आवश्यकता है तो रूपांतरण कैलकुलेटर या यहां तक कि कुछ मोबाइल एप्लिकेशन जैसे प्लेटफ़ॉर्म बहुत मददगार हो सकते हैं। हालाँकि, प्रक्रिया जानने से आपको यह समझने में मदद मिलेगी कि ये उपकरण आंतरिक रूप से कैसे काम करते हैं।
इस बात पर जोर देना महत्वपूर्ण है कि यद्यपि आप इन कैलकुलेटर का उपयोग कर सकते हैं, लेकिन हमारे द्वारा बताए गए चरणों को जानना फायदेमंद है क्योंकि वे आपको बेहतर ढंग से समझने की अनुमति देंगे कि हेक्साडेसिमल नंबरिंग प्रणाली कैसे काम करती है।